Transaction

58653d271a111275f64a5f573f43bd7eb54c4c4057a23641d0a0acba06c1b66d

Summary

Mined Time Fri, 13 Apr 2018 15:30:50 UTC
In Block 3b3f21f58b2399cf6443b8cfd180cd989910c9119e1cf58b88c98c594edce49d
In Block Height 6422030
Total Input 3150.71315988 DGB
Total Output 3150.71231988 DGB
Fees 0.00084 DGB

Details